Two dilatometers are presented here that were developed for the use with, but not limited to, low-shrink unsaturated polyester resins. One of the dilatometers, made from a glass syringe and two aluminum plates, was limited to lower pressures. The other dilatometer, similar in design to the first, was made from a hydraulic cylinder and was capable of pressures to 500 psi. The dilatometers were calibrated and tested by the polymerization of styrene. Several low-shrink unsaturated polyester resins were cured in the dilatometers and the results of these experiments are given. The interactions of volume change, rheology change, conversion, and microstructure formation were also measured. Finally, the effect of pressure was considered.
